It’s a great option for beginners and seasoned aquarists alike.How to Create the Ideal HabitatThis species thrives in aquariums of at least 80 litres. Provide driftwood, rock caves, and low light areas to suit its nocturnal habits. Maintain a water temperature between 26°C and 28°C with a pH of 6.5 to 7.8. Good filtration and 20–30% weekly water changes are essential for long-term health.Compatible Tank Mates for a Bristlenose Catfish MaleBristlenose Catfish Male generally live peacefully with guppies, neon tetras, mollies, and other community species. Avoid housing multiple males together unless you have a very spacious tank with several hiding places to reduce territorial behaviour.Feeding GuideThough they consume algae, they also need supplemental food. Offer algae wafers, blanched vegetables (such as zucchini or cucumber), and ensure driftwood is available for digestive support. Feed once daily and remove uneaten food to maintain water quality.Breeding InformationBreeding is straightforward in a tank equipped with caves. The male guards eggs laid by the female until they hatch, typically within a few days.
